Transaction e0ebece10399fc1b4d609091eda8aefddc27bd950ea22af5340de78617531348
1 Input
1 Output
-
e0ebece10399fc1b4d609091eda8aefddc27bd950ea22af5340de78617531348:0
- value
- 9376171
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42cced1da30ca19535401ce264a231f9ea127f5a OP_EQUAL
- address
- 37nE1jED9ogb9T5ZHSvtzA7S5jAnjPkvKJ